?
DNS解析是指将域名解析为对应的IP地址的过程,使得用户可以通过域名访问网站。下面是网站解决DNS解析的常见方法:
- 域名注册和DNS解析服务:网站首先需要注册一个域名,并选择一个可靠的域名注册商,注册商通常会提供DNS解析服务。通过域名注册商提供的管理界面,网站管理员可以设置DNS解析记录,将域名映射到相应的IP地址。
- 使用专用DNS服务器:对于大型网站或需要较高的解析速度和稳定性的网站,可以选择使用专用的DNS服务器。这些服务器通常由云服务提供商或专业的DNS解析服务提供商托管,可以实现快速且可靠的DNS解析。
- DNS负载均衡:为了提高网站的可用性和性能,可以使用DNS负载均衡来分散流量。通过配置多个具有相同域名但不同IP地址的解析记录,当用户发起DNS解析请求时,DNS服务器会返回其中一个IP地址,实现流量的均衡分发。
- TTL设置:网站管理员可以通过设置TTL(Time-to-Live)值来控制DNS解析记录的缓存时间。较短的TTL值可以使得DNS解析记录更快地被更新,但同时也增加了DNS解析的负载。较长的TTL值可以减轻DNS服务器负担,但域名的变更可能需要更长的时间被用户感知。
- CDN加速:对于全球分布的网站,可以使用内容分发网络(CDN)来加速DNS解析和网站访问。CDN通过在全球各地部署节点服务器,将网站的静态资源缓存在离用户最近的节点,提供更快的访问速度和更好的用户体验。
腾讯云相关产品推荐:
- 腾讯云域名注册服务:提供域名注册和DNS解析服务,支持一键配置常见网站类型的解析记录。链接地址:https://cloud.tencent.com/product/domain
- 腾讯云全球加速(CDN):通过在全球部署节点服务器,提供加速服务,包括DNS解析加速。链接地址:https://cloud.tencent.com/product/cdn